Role Outline

The Media Planner/ Buyer will be the day-to-day steward for an assigned client(s), including accurate budget control and flow of media activity. The person in this role will be required to maintain a strong knowledge of their clients' business to deliver against their needs and objectives.

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
Knowledge: 

  • Display a mastery of media fundamentals across all channels.
  • Show a keen interest in and knowledge of emerging trends across the media landscape.
  • Demonstrate proficiency with industry systems/tools (TGI, GWI, Ebiquity)
  • Support ideation, meet regularly with Media Owners and keep up to date with industry news, so that you are abreast of developments and can talk confidently to clients about new, innovative solutions and in doing so, continue to push the boundaries of their marketing so that we are consistently delivering the most effective solutions for them

Strategic thinking: Understand the client’s business, the industry in which they operate, their business and campaign objectives and the difference between those two. Understand how to build stories to deliver insights in an effective and convincing way to drive media recommendations.

Planning: Understand the media mix, phasing, targeting, key partners, and the detail behind media.

Relationships: Build trustworthy relationships internally, with agency partners and with clients and appropriately respond to client needs. effective media plans and talk confidently about them with a client. Create insightful PCAs and ensure that their learnings follow through into future campaigns.

Buying: Comfortable with using booking systems and billing processes so that invoices are sent out and paid on time. Should also have an eye on commercial opportunities, from barter to short term offers, in order to leverage maximum value for both the client and the business.

Ideation: Thinking a little differently when it comes to problem-solving, to design innovative, creative solutions and delivering them to clients in an engaging and coherent way.

Team building: Supervise, mentor and grow Executive Planners, and Apprentices.

What We Do

IPG Mediabrands is the media and marketing solutions division of Interpublic Group (NYSE: IPG). IPG Mediabrands manages over $47 billion in marketing investment globally on behalf of its clients across its full-service agency networks UM, Initiative and Mediahub and through its award-winning specialized business units Healix, KINESSO, MAGNA, Mediabrands Content Studio, Orion Holdings, Rapport, and the IPG Media Lab. IPG Mediabrands clients include many of the world’s most recognizable and iconic brands from a broad portfolio of industry sectors including automotive, personal finance, consumer product goods (CPG), pharma, health and wellness, entertainment, financial services, energy, toys and gaming, direct to consumer and e-commerce, retail, hospitality, food and beverage, fashion and beauty. The company employs more than 18,000 diverse marketing communication professionals in more than 130 countries. Learn more at www.ipgmediabrands.com
